Warning issued for Bay Area shellfish... It could be LETHAL!

The California Department of Public Health issued a warning Wednesday advising people not to eat  harvested mussels, clams or scallops from San Francisco and San Mateo counties, where dangerous levels of PSP were found in mussels.  The California Department of Public Health explained "Dangerous levels of paralytic shellfish poisoning (PSP) toxins have been detected in mussels from this area. The naturally occurring PSP toxins can cause illness or death in humans. Cooking does not destroy the toxin." 

But good news... This warning does not apply to commercially sold clams, mussels, scallops or oysters from approved sources.
